Publisher Marketing: Cling A bull's-eye Cling Another bull's-eye, I declare Cling Three bull's-eyes, of all things Snap, you are getting to be a wonder with the rifle. Why, even old Jed Sanborn couldn't do better than that. Charley Dodge, a bright, manly boy of fifteen, laid down the rifle on the counter in the shooting gallery and smiled quietly. I guess it was more luck than anything, Shep, he replied. Perhaps I couldn't do it again. Nonsense, came from Sheppard Reed, also a boy of fifteen. You have got it in you to shoot straight and that is all there is to it. I only wish I could shoot as well. Contributor Bio:  Stratemeyer, Edward Edward Stratemeyer (1862-1930) is known primarily for his novels for the young. Creator of such classic series as The Bobbsey Twins, The Hardy Boys, and the Nancy Drew series, he also wrote many historical novels. Most, including FOR THE LIBERTY OF TEXAS, relate to the great conflicts of the nineteenth century.
